About TEGNA
TEGNA Inc. (NYSE: TGNA) helps people thrive in their local communities by providing the trusted local news and services that matter most. With 64 television stations in 51 U.S. markets, TEGNA reaches more than 100 million people monthly across the web, mobile apps, streaming, and linear television. KFMB, the TEGNA-owned CBS affiliate in San Diego, Ca, has an opening for an experienced, versatile Supervisor of Technology. We are looking for a proven leader with strong technical judgment, effective communication skills, possessing an understanding of current and future technology needs with a passion for innovation.
The Supervisor of Technology is responsible for leading the engineering, IT teams that support the overall KFMB broadcast technologies in a 24/7/365 environment.
Responsibilities:
• Managing short- and long-term technology strategy.
• Day-to-day operations including equipment integration, maintenance for the core infrastructure, studios, control rooms, facility, post-production, and transmission for all live programming.
• Oversee compliance with FCC rules and regulations.
• Manage compliance with critical security policies, including account, password security, vulnerability protection, virus protection, untrusted network, and IT incident reporting policies.
• Manage business continuity and disaster/cyber security contingency plans.
• Maintain financial responsibility for the engineering department including expense budgeting, approvals, and reviews.
• Oversee station OSHA compliance.
• Monitor and scrutinize daily on-air technical quality.
• Lead workflow improvements for both on-air and online products.
• Manage vendor contracts including technology, building maintenance, security, and janitorial services.
• Lead project planning and project management for station-wide initiatives.
Requirements:
• Strong customer service skills and unfailing professionalism. Impeccable written and verbal communication and presentation skills for both technical and non-technical audiences.
• Demonstrated strong leadership with a focus on team management.
• Understanding of IT processes including security, workflow, and management.
• In-depth knowledge of broadcast technologies including: ENPS, production control room automation, RF transmission, broadcast switchers, router systems, field cameras, and signal path workflows.
• Strong project management experience.
• Ability to work well and make quick decisions under pressure.
• Bachelor’s degree or equivalent combination of experience and education and a minimum of five year’s experience in a broadcast operations/technology management role.
